Getting Started
User Guide
API Reference
RAGAssistant
RAGAssistant.__init__()
RAGAssistant.add_documents()
RAGAssistant.remove_documents()
RAGAssistant.update_documents()
RAGAssistant.retrieve()
RAGAssistant.retrieve_with_context()
RAGAssistant.get_context_with_window()
RAGAssistant.get_context()
RAGAssistant.generate()
RAGAssistant.ask()
RAGAssistant.generate_code()
RAGAssistant.num_chunks
RAGAssistant.chunk_count
RAGAssistant.is_indexed
RAGAssistant.num_documents
RAGAssistant.has_llm
RAGAssistant.save_index()
RAGAssistant.load_index()
RagitExperiment
RagitExperiment.__init__()
RagitExperiment.provider
RagitExperiment.define_search_space()
RagitExperiment.evaluate_config()
RagitExperiment.run()
RagitExperiment.get_best_config()
Document
BenchmarkQuestion
EvaluationResult
ExperimentResults
SimpleVectorStore
SimpleVectorStore.__init__()
SimpleVectorStore.chunks
SimpleVectorStore.add()
SimpleVectorStore.clear()
SimpleVectorStore.search()
OllamaProvider
OllamaProvider.EMBEDDING_DIMENSIONS
OllamaProvider.MAX_EMBED_CHARS
OllamaProvider.DEFAULT_TIMEOUTS
OllamaProvider.__init__()
OllamaProvider.session
OllamaProvider.close()
OllamaProvider.provider_name
OllamaProvider.dimensions
OllamaProvider.is_available()
OllamaProvider.list_models()
OllamaProvider.generate()
OllamaProvider.embed()
OllamaProvider.embed_batch()
OllamaProvider.embed_batch_async()
OllamaProvider.chat()
OllamaProvider.generate_circuit_status
OllamaProvider.embed_circuit_status
OllamaProvider.clear_embedding_cache()
OllamaProvider.embedding_cache_info()
BaseLLMProvider
BaseEmbeddingProvider
LLMResponse
EmbeddingResponse
load_text()
load_directory()
chunk_text()
chunk_document()
chunk_by_separator()
chunk_rst_sections()
Chunk
Community